About GOAT Group

GOAT Group operates four brands—GOAT, Flight Club, Grailed, and alias—focused on providing authentic sneakers, apparel, and accessories to a global community of over 50 million members in 170 countries. The company connects buyers and sellers through its platforms, ensuring product authenticity with strict verification processes. Revenue is generated through transaction fees, premium services, and partnerships. GOAT Group stands out in the competitive fashion and streetwear market by catering to sneaker enthusiasts, fashion-forward individuals, and collectors, while leveraging its technological infrastructure to create a secure and seamless marketplace experience.
